
Morgan Spector, portraying the extreme capitalist and oil baron George Russell in HBO’s The Gilded Age, surprisingly identifies as a socialist off-screen. He has enjoyed contrasting his personal beliefs with his character, rather than merging them. In an interview with Rolling Stone, he stated that introducing criticism of the character into his performance would make it less engaging. Instead, he emphasized that to truly embody the character, one must adopt their values wholeheartedly.
Now, Spector is channeling this extensive experience into advocating for his political beliefs. He recently filmed a campaign commercial for Zohran Mamdani‘s mayoral bid, where he appears as Mr. Russell. In the ad, while dressed as the oil baron, he reads an August 30th New York Times article about the Hamptons elite fearing Mamdani after his primary victory over Andrew Cuomo. These wealthy individuals are hosting exclusive pro-Cuomo dinners while Mamdani gains support by simply stating, “I don’t think we should have billionaires.” From George Russell’s mouth, these words echo the sentiments of the 1880s robber barons.

The video is packed with noteworthy instances, but some standouts include Spector’s distinctive pronunciation of “Cu-oh-mo” and his self-satisfied tone when disclosing that a Cuomo supporter previously worked for Melania Trump. However, the most captivating moment occurs during his recitation of the quote: “His social media is amusing, and his proposals seem reasonable until you delve into the details and they’re not achievable.” As this sentence unfolds, Spector fixes his gaze on the camera, flaunting a crystal glass and an alluring, menacing smile.
